Android QA/Test Engineer
FocusKPI is looking for an SDET Android System or Android QA / Test Engineer to join one of our clients, a high-tech SaaS company.
The team is looking for an Android QA / Test Engineer to help ensure the quality, stability, and performance of Android-based system features and services. In this role, you will work closely with developers, program managers, and QA teams to test Android components across devices and releases, with a strong focus on automation, debugging, and system reliability.
This role is ideal for engineers with hands-on Android testing experience who are interested in deeper system behavior and debugging, including applications that rely on native components.
Work Location: Mountain View, CA
Duration: 12-month contract with potential to extend; On-site role (5 days a week onsite)
Pay Range: $75/hr - 86/hr

Role & Responsibilities:
- Understand product and business requirements and contribute to test planning and execution across functional, integration, regression, and performance testing.
- Perform end-to-end testing of Android products, including execution on real Android mobile devices.
- Design and execute test cases for Android system features, APIs, and services.
- Develop, maintain, and improve automated tests for Android services and applications.
- Contribute to the enhancement of Android test automation frameworks.
- Perform performance and benchmark testing on key system metrics, including battery usage, memory consumption, and boot time.
- Debug application and system-level issues on Android, including applications and native components, using standard Android debugging tools and debuggers.
- Analyze logs and runtime behavior to help identify the cause of crashes, freezes, and stability issues.
- Clearly document issues and collaborate with development teams to drive resolution.
- Take ownership of quality for assigned features during regular release cycles.
- Work closely with developers, QA leads, and program managers to deliver high-quality releases.
- Contribute to a strong engineering culture that values quality across all Android features and services.
- 5+ years of experience in Android system testing or QA (application, system, or framework level).
- Education: Master's in Computer Science or equivalent
- Mandatory to have experience with Low level android components/system and how it works
- Experience writing test automation or scripts using Java, Python, or similar languages.
- Expertise in Android debugging tools such as ADB, Logcat, and Memory Analyzer.
- Knowledge in the Android system and its layered architecture, from the foundation of the Linux kernel to the user-facing applications, including the Android Framework.
- Solid understanding of Android fundamentals, including components, lifecycles, and system services.
- Excellent understanding of QA processes, test methodologies, and defect tracking.
-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Understanding of kernel debugging concepts and system-level analysis.
- Awareness of Trusted Execution Environment (TEE) and Trusted Applications (TA).
- Experience testing Android builds or custom Android images.
- Familiarity with Android build tools (e.g., Gradle).
- Interest or exposure to performance testing, benchmarking, or AI-related features on Android.
